Landscape grading and resloping involve improving the surface to enhance drainage, prevent disintegration, and produce visually enticing outside spaces. Correct grading directs water far from structures, decreases pooling, and supports healthy plant growth. The procedure starts with assessing the existing topography, soil type, and preferred water circulation. Heavy machinery or hand grading might be utilized to change slopes, level locations for yards, and produce practical spaces such as balconies or sidewalks. Resloping likewise supports long-term landscape health by preventing soil disintegration, lowering tension on plants, and maintaining appropriate drain. Well-executed grading guarantees structural stability, enhances aesthetic appeal, and safeguards the home from water-related damage
